+STMicroelectronics STM32 Factory-programmed data device tree bindings
+
+This represents STM32 Factory-programmed read only non-volatile area: locked
+flash, OTP, read-only HW regs... This contains various information such as:
+analog calibration data for temperature sensor (e.g. TS_CAL1, TS_CAL2),
+internal vref (VREFIN_CAL), unique device ID...
+
+Required properties:
+- compatible:          Should be one of:
+                       "st,stm32-romem"
+                       "st,stm32mp15-bsec"
+- reg:                 Offset and length of factory-programmed area.
+- #address-cells:      Should be '<1>'.
+- #size-cells:         Should be '<1>'.
+
+Optional Data cells:
+- Must be child nodes as described in nvmem.txt.
+
+Example on stm32f4:
+       romem: nvmem@1fff7800 {
+               compatible = "st,stm32-romem";
+               reg = <0x1fff7800 0x400>;
+               #address-cells = <1>;
+               #size-cells = <1>;
+
+               /* Data cells: ts_cal1 at 0x1fff7a2c */
+               ts_cal1: calib@22c {
+                       reg = <0x22c 0x2>;
+               };
+               ...
+       };
